Dining Options on MSC Cruises
When it comes to dining on an MSC Cruise, you’ll be spoiled for choice. From elegant restaurants to casual buffets, there’s something for every taste and preference. The main dining rooms on board offer a range of international cuisine, including Mediterranean, Asian, and American-inspired dishes. You’ll also find specialty restaurants, such as steakhouses and seafood restaurants, which offer a more upscale dining experience.
In addition to the main dining rooms and specialty restaurants, you’ll also find a range of casual dining options, including buffets, snack bars, and poolside eateries. These are perfect for grabbing a quick bite or snack, and offer a more relaxed atmosphere than the formal dining rooms.
Additional Charges for Dining
While the majority of dining options on an MSC Cruise are included in the package, there may be some additional charges for certain restaurants or services. For example, room service may incur a small fee, and some specialty restaurants may charge a cover charge or require a reservation. It’s always a good idea to check the pricing and policies for each restaurant before you dine, to avoid any unexpected charges.
It’s also worth noting that some dining experiences, such as wine tastings or chef’s tables, may be available for an additional fee. These experiences offer a unique and exclusive dining experience, and are a great way to indulge in some of the finer things in life. However, they can be pricey, so it’s essential to factor them into your budget before you book.
Special Dietary Accommodations
MSC Cruises understand that many passengers have special dietary needs or preferences, and offer a range of options to cater to these requirements. From gluten-free and vegetarian to vegan and kosher, there are plenty of options available to suit every dietary need.
To ensure that your dietary needs are met, it’s essential to inform the cruise line of your requirements before you sail. This can be done through the online booking system or by contacting the cruise line directly. Once on board, you can also speak with the dining staff or the ship’s culinary team to discuss your options and make arrangements for special meals.
Formal Dress Code Requirements
While the dress code on an MSC Cruise is generally relaxed, there are some formal events and restaurants that require more elegant attire. For example, the main dining rooms may have a formal night, where passengers are encouraged to dress up in their finest clothes.
It’s essential to check the dress code policy for each restaurant and event before you attend, to avoid any embarrassment or disappointment. You can find this information on the cruise line’s website or by checking the daily newsletter on board. By dressing accordingly, you’ll be able to enjoy the formal events and restaurants without worrying about what to wear.
